              I don't think it is your issue but if you heat the coils with a hair drier while measuring the resistance you will see if there is a crack in the coil that causes issues when the engine is warm. I was just wondering if cycling the coils (trying to start the bike) might open them up..

                          • #28
                            OK if it is cranking then that excludes all th interlocks.
                            You are down to what you started with.
                            Sig gen
                            CDI
                            coils
                            wiring
                            plugs..
